DENALI NATIONAL PARK
Dog Feed Cache & Sled Storage Building (1920)

The utility building serves as a dog pen, bedding and feeding area, as well as storage and repair space for the dog sleds used to get around the park during winter. Note the dog sled, the carved nameplates for the dogs and the various supplies and tools stacked against and hung on the smooth plank walls.
